摘要

Two novel organic-inorganic composite phosphotungstates, [H9{Ce(α-PW11O39)2}Cu(en)2] · 6H2O (1) and H7[Cu(en)2{Er(α-PW11O39)2}Cu(en)2] · 12H2O (2) (en = ethylenediamine) have been synthesized by the hydrothermal reaction of the trivacant Keggin polyoxoanion [α-A-PW9O34]9- with CeIII or ErIII ions in the presence of Cu2+ ions and en, and structurally characterized by IR spectra, elemental analysis and thermogravimetric analysis. X-ray crystallographic analyses indicate that they are all built by sandwich-type [Ln(α-PW11O39)2]11- (Ln = CeIII, ErIII) polyoxoanions and [Cu(en)2]2+ cations generating infinite one-dimensional arrangements. To our knowledge, this 1-D chain structures constituted by mono-Ln sandwiched POM units and transition-metal complex cations are very rare.
